为了研究在激光驱动的尾场中被加速正电子的动能,采用数值模拟方法,得到了非对称sine脉冲、flat-top脉冲和Gaussian脉冲驱动的尾场中被加速的正电子的能量.结果表明,非对称sine脉冲驱动尾场中正电子得到的能量比flat-top脉冲和Gaussian脉冲驱动尾场中得到的能量高一些.%In order to study the kinetic energy of the accelerated positrons in the wakefield of different laser pulses, by means of numerical simulation, the kinetic energy was obtained in the wakefiled of sine, flat-top and Gaussian asymmetric laser pulses. Simulation results show the energy driven by asymmetric sine pulses is higher than those driven by flat-top and Gaussian laser pulses.
